The Barbados Chess Federation Inc


Rules and Regulations

ELIGIBILITY: Open to all persons born on or after Jan. 01 1984
FORMAT: 8 Round Swiss
VENUE : The Headquarters of National Union of Public Workers (NUPW), Dalkeith Road, St. Michael, Barbados.

Defaults Default time is 1 hour after official start time and players defaulting without notifying Tournament Director within 24 hours will be automatically withdrawn from next round.
Ratings This competition will be eligible for BCF Ratings.
Fees Bds$ 10.
Prizes 1st  -Trophy & Bds $ 250.00 Prize Voucher, 2nd and 3rd place Trophies; 1st; 2nd & 3rd place Trophies for age category (10, 12, 14 & 16); Special prizes: best female player, youngest player, best game etc.  The final list of prizes will be displayed at the venue before the opening ceremony.
TIE BREAK: Sum of the Progressive Score, followed by Buchholz and Sonnenborn-Berger. If tie still exists it will be broken by a play-off.
